Job description

Description:

The Computer Engineer III/IV architects, develops, integrates, and tests advanced hardware/software solutions for mission systems across NSWC Crane’s digital engineering portfolio. This senior engineer spans embedded processing, networked computing, and edge analytics, ensuring that designs meet requirements for performance, reliability, cybersecurity, and manufacturability from concept through production deployment. The role partners with systems engineering, manufacturing, logistics, and government IPT leads to mature prototypes, supervise build-and-install efforts, and drive continuous improvement across platforms and labs. This position is contingent upon award. Award is expected by the end of the year (2026).
 

Requirements:

- Master’s degree in Computer Engineering, Electrical/Electronics Engineering, or Mathematics with a concentration in computer science.
- 7+ years of professional experience in computer design, software development, or computer networks, including responsibility for end-to-end integration and verification.
- Deep knowledge of computer architecture, embedded processing, interface protocols, and operating systems relevant to Navy/DoD mission computing.
- Proven ability to translate system requirements into robust hardware/software implementations, conduct trade studies, and manage risk across performance, schedule, and cost constraints.
- Experience supervising manufacturing or installation of computer systems and conducting formal verification/validation with government stakeholders.
- Familiarity with secure development practices, cybersecurity compliance (RMF/DoD guidelines), and documentation required for Navy accreditation packages.
- Excellent communication skills for leading design reviews, writing technical documentation, and briefing senior government leadership.
- Active DoD Secret clearance (or clearable to that level) required due to access to classified programs and facilities.

- Demonstrated leadership designing and fielding complex computer hardware/software systems for DoD platforms, preferably within NSWC Crane mission areas (EW, sensors, weapons, or expeditionary systems).
- Strong background in full-lifecycle digital engineering, including model-based design, rapid prototyping, hardware-in-the-loop testing, and configuration management.
- Hands-on proficiency with modern programming languages (C/C++, Python, Java) and HDL/tool flows for FPGA or ASIC development, plus experience integrating COTS single-board computers and networking hardware.
- Prior success coordinating manufacturing, installation, and sustainment activities with multi-company teams, ensuring interface compliance and producibility.
